On Fri, Oct 18, 2002 at 04:05:52PM -0400, David Megginson wrote:
Andy Ross writes:
The attached one-liner fixes the problem, but someone with more
knowlege should probably think of a better solution. We shouldn't be
initializing static state from within a member initializer. Maybe
I grabbed current CVS last night for the first time in a while, and
got bitten by a bug with the 3D panel support. Has anyone else
noticed this? What happens is that on an aircraft with no 2D panel at
all (a4, c172-3d, but oddly not the j3cub), the sim crashes at
startup. The first problem was
Andy Ross writes:
The attached one-liner fixes the problem, but someone with more
knowlege should probably think of a better solution. We shouldn't be
initializing static state from within a member initializer. Maybe
there's a need for a panel subsystem as separate from the individual
Andy Ross writes:
I continue to believe that a 2D panel layout is an easier problem for
cockpit wonks to deal with than a 3D modelling application is, FWIW.
Some instruments, like the gyro ball, really are inherently 3D and
can't be easily placed on a 2D panel. But pretty much everything